    In everyday life, electricity is used everywhere, and the risks of electrocution can be hidden in outlets, appliances, wires, etc. When beaten accidentally, many people are mistreated for panic, which exacerbates harm. The electrocution can lead to skin burns, muscle spasms, severe damage to organs such as the heart, kidneys and even life-threatening. Capturing the right electrocution methods can reduce injuries and save lives at critical times. This paper will provide a detailed account of the scientific response to electrocution from emergency disposal, follow-up care and risk prevention。

    I. In the moment of electrocution: the golden first aid step cannot be wrong

    1. Ensuring their own safety and cutting off power

    We found someone with electrical contact. Don't pull it with your hand! First, the power switch is to be cut quickly, and if it is not found, dry wooden sticks, bamboo poles, plastic rods, etc. Can be used to separate the electrocutor from the power source or the body with the electrical. The operation must ensure that you are standing where you are dry, avoiding slippage or contact with other conductive objects at your feet and preventing you from being electrocuted。

    2. Rapid determination of electrocutor status

    When the power is cut, the consciousness, breathing and pulse of the electrocutor are immediately observed. If the electrocutor is conscious, is able to speak and breathe normally, he/she is able to rest slowly, he/she is ventilated in his/her surroundings and he/she is prevented from moving his/her body at will. If the electrocutor is in a coma, weak breathing or stops, and his/her pulse disappears, the next first aid must be activated immediately。

    3. Timely call for help and initial first aid

    Call the emergency telephone number 120 immediately to give a clear indication of the location, state of the wounded and contact details. When waiting for an ambulance, if the person with the electrocutor is breathing or having his heartbeat stopped, cpr (outside chest pressure + artificial respiration) is performed immediately until the arrival of a specialist medical practitioner. At the same time, calls for help from the surroundings can be made to allow others to help maintain order on the ground and to avoid unconnected crowding。

    Follow-up care and observation points

    Initial treatment of skin damage

    Skin burns, bruises, bubbles, etc. May occur as a result of electrocution, at which point the clothing in the part of the injury shall not be torn, and the wound may be covered lightly with clean gauze or towels to keep it clean and dry. If there is a slight haemorrhage in the wound, the blood can first be stopped with a clean cotton stamp, avoiding any random ointment of unknown medicine, which would cause infection or influence the doctor's judgement。

    Close observation of physical state

    Even if the electrocutors are conscious and appear harmless, they cannot be taken lightly. The electrocution can lead to “delayed injuries”, such as dizziness, nausea, chest suffocation, abdominal pain, etc., several hours later. The wounded must rest in peace and constantly observe physical changes within 48 hours, during which time severe physical activity, drinking and nighttime are avoided, and diets must be easily digested to supplement sufficient moisture。

    3. Targeted treatment of special situations

    If the electrocutor is electrocuted with muscular acidity, body numbness, etc., the electrical current may have damaged the nerve or muscle, and it is necessary to avoid the intense activity of the body and to keep it relaxed, pending further examination by the doctor. In the case of electrocution accompanied by secondary damage, such as a high-altitude crash or impact, care is taken to protect the injured person's cervical and lumbar vertebrae, avoid moving at will and wait for medical personnel to transfer using specialized equipment。

    Iii. Preventive: daily electricity safety precautions

    1. Regulation of the use of electrical equipment

    The purchase of electrical appliances is based on the choice of a formal brand with 3c certified products, avoiding the use of “three-nil” appliances. The electrical appliances are checked for wiring, plugs, etc., before they are used, and if they are damaged, ageing, leaks, etc., their use is stopped and replaced. Do not use wet hands when lifting plugs, and avoid pulling wires hard to prevent their breaking and leakage。

    2. Household electricity protection

    Intubation booths and switches are to be installed in unattractive places for children and can be used to shield idle outlets. In humid environments such as toilets and kitchens, waterproof electrical appliances and leakproof outlets are used to avoid direct electrical access to water sources. Household circuits are regularly checked, and the circuits of old houses are changed and replaced in a timely manner to prevent the ageing of the circuits from causing electrocution。

    3. Raising self-security awareness

    In daily life, it is necessary to stay away from dangerous areas such as high-voltage wires, transformers, and not to climb utility poles and touch open wires. Learn basic safe use of electricity to inform the elderly and children about the hazards of electrocution and simple prevention methods. In case of electrical failure, do not self-destruct maintenance and contact a professional electrician for processing。

    When electrocuted, the correct treatment is directly related to the degree of injury. The core principle is to cut the power and keep it safe, then to judge the state for first aid and, finally, to observe care. At the same time, the use of electrical appliances and the detection of safety hazards are regulated in order to reduce the risk of electrocution at its root. Bearing in mind this knowledge, it can protect itself and help others when they are at risk。
